Justice League War (Animated)
Info here: http://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Justice_League:_War
Quote:
"Justice League: War," directed by Jay Oliva, scripted by Heath Corson, and starring the voices of Jason O'Mara (Batman), Alan Tudyk (Superman), Michelle Monaghan (Wonder Woman), Christopher Gorham (Barry Allen), Justin Kirk (Green Lantern), Shemar Moore (Cyborg), Sean Astin (Shazam) and Steven Blum (Darkseid), is expected to be released in early 2014.
